About The Position

You will manage and administer SharePoint Services, Internet Information Services (IIS), Enterprise Certificate Services, Microsoft 365, and be an active contributor in the team. You'll support request handling and collaborate professionally across the team, with opportunities to contribute to broader group initiatives. The position will provide support for the Office of Information Technology and all customers we support. The position performs a full range of system administration functions to control systems and attain maximum utilization and efficiency within the SharePoint/Web Services team. This position maintains updating infrastructure, administering, and supporting on premise/cloud environments, administering SharePoint and IIS enterprise environments and issuing and maintaining Enterprise Certificates. The position is a key player in the support and maintenance of all users within the States systems as far as access control. The Team within the Office of Information Technology offers professional and technical hosting and enterprise services to agencies. The Team resides within the Computing Infrastructure & Services Group, which supports a wide range of applications utilizing Windows Server, Microsoft 365, Microsoft Teams, Directory Services, Enterprise Backup and Storage, SQL Server, IIS, SharePoint, and other COTS products. Work is performed under supervision. This position is in Augusta. The CIS Group requires 24x7 server support. This requires the position to be on-call in a rotation format.

Benefits

  • Work-Life Balance - Rest is essential. Take time for yourself using 13 paid holidays, 12 days of sick leave, and 3+ weeks of vacation leave annually. Vacation leave accrual increases with years of service, and overtime-exempt employees receive personal leave.
  • Health Insurance Coverage - The State of Maine pays 85%-100% of employee-only premiums ($11,857.68-$13,950.24 annual value), depending on salary. Use this chart to find the premium costs for you and your family, including the percentage of dependent coverage paid by the State.
  • Health Insurance Premium Credit - Participation decreases employee-only premiums by 5%. Visit the Office of Employee Health and Wellness for more information about program requirements.
  • Dental Insurance - The State of Maine pays 100% of employee-only dental premiums ($365.28 annual value).
  • Retirement Plan - The State of Maine contributes 14.11% of pay to the Maine Public Employees Retirement System (MainePERS), on behalf of the employee.
  • Gym Membership Reimbursement - Improve overall health with regular exercise and receive up to $40 per month to offset this expense.
  • Health and Dependent Care Flexible Spending Accounts - Set aside money pre-tax to help pay for out-of-pocket health care expenses and/or daycare expenses.
  • Public Service Student Loan Forgiveness - The State of Maine is a qualified employer for this federal program. For more information, visit the Federal Student Aid office.
  • Living Resources Program - Navigate challenging work and life situations with our employee assistance program.
  • Parental leave is one of the most important benefits for any working parent. All employees who are welcoming a child-including fathers and adoptive parents-receive forty-two (42) consecutive calendar days of fully paid parental leave. Additional, unpaid leave may also be available, under the Family and Medical Leave Act.
  • Voluntary Deferred Compensation - Save additional pre-tax funds for retirement in a MaineSaves 457(b) account through payroll deductions.
